A yellow pothos leaf does not identify one cause. Normal aging, saturated roots, a dry root ball, abrupt light or temperature changes, fertilizer salts, insects, and disease can produce overlapping symptoms. Treating the color alone can make the real problem worse: watering a plant with rotting roots, for example, adds stress rather than relieving it.
Use this guide as a decision process. Observe first, change one important condition at a time, and judge the newest growth rather than expecting a yellow leaf to turn green again.
First, confirm that the color is abnormal
Golden pothos (Epipremnum aureum) naturally has yellow-green variegation, while cultivars such as ‘Marble Queen,’ ‘Neon,’ ‘Lime,’ and ‘Pearls and Jade’ have cream, chartreuse, or pale areas by design. The University of Wisconsin-Madison Extension pothos profile illustrates these normal cultivar patterns.
Variegation has defined areas that repeat across otherwise firm, healthy leaves. Stress-related yellowing is a loss of normal color: it may spread through a previously green section, affect an entire leaf, or arrive with wilting, spots, soft tissue, pests, or stalled growth.
One older leaf yellowing near the base of a healthy vine may be ordinary senescence. Both Wisconsin Extension and the North Carolina Extension Plant Toolbox note that older pothos leaves eventually yellow and fall. Several leaves changing quickly, yellowing on new growth, or yellowing paired with stem or root damage deserves investigation.
Read the whole pattern
| Pattern | Evidence to check | Most useful first response |
|---|---|---|
| One oldest leaf yellows; new growth is firm | No pests, spots, odor, or widespread decline | Monitor; remove the leaf when it detaches easily |
| Several leaves yellow while mix remains wet | Drainage, standing water, soft roots, sour odor | Stop adding water and inspect the root zone |
| Plant wilts and mix is very dry | Pot weight, mix pulling from pot, whether water runs around a dry root ball | Re-wet the entire root zone slowly, then reassess |
| Plant wilts even though mix is wet | Dark, soft roots or a loose stem base | Treat as possible root loss, not thirst |
| Pale or stretched new growth; variegation fades | Distance from usable window or grow light | Increase light gradually |
| Bleached areas or dry patches face the window | Recent move or strong direct sun | Move out of harsh direct exposure; retain bright filtered light |
| Fine stippling, webbing, cottony masses, brown bumps, or sticky leaves | Leaf undersides, nodes, pot rim, nearby plants | Isolate and identify the pest before treatment |
| Yellowing with brown or black leaf tips | Moisture history and fertilizer use | Correct water management first; consider salt buildup only with supporting history |
The table ranks checks, not diagnoses. A plant can have more than one problem, and leaf appearance alone cannot confirm a particular nutrient deficiency or pathogen.
Check the root zone before watering again
Pothos grows best in an aerated medium that drains, with watering after the surface begins to dry. It is not a plant that benefits from permanently wet mix. Wisconsin Extension identifies overwatering as the usual cause of pothos root rot, and the University of Maryland indoor-plant diagnostic guide describes healthy roots as firm and light-colored and diseased roots as dark and soft.
Do not use a fixed “every seven days” schedule. Drying speed changes with pot size, mix, season, light, temperature, and the size of the root system. Instead:
- Feel below the surface or insert an unfinished wooden skewer into the root zone.
- Lift the pot and compare its weight with its weight just after a thorough watering.
- Confirm that water can leave through drainage holes and that the pot is not standing in runoff.
- If the mix is wet and the plant is declining, slide out the root ball and inspect it rather than adding more water.
Firm roots and an earthy smell argue against advanced rot. Soft, collapsing roots, missing feeder roots, a foul smell, or a soft stem base support a root-rot diagnosis. Root color varies with potting media and species, so color without texture and odor is not enough.
If the root ball is waterlogged
Empty any cachepot or saucer, clear blocked drainage, and let an intact root system regain an appropriate wet-dry cycle. If roots are rotting, use clean pruners to remove tissue that is plainly soft and dead, then repot the viable plant in a clean container with fresh, well-drained houseplant mix. Maryland Extension recommends removing rotten portions and replanting the healthy remainder; a severely damaged plant may be better discarded.
Do not fertilize a plant with active root loss. Fertilizer cannot replace roots and may add soluble salts while the plant is least able to use them.
If the root ball is very dry
Apply room-temperature water slowly across the surface until the full root ball is moist and excess drains. If dried mix repels water, repeat in small passes or soak the pot briefly from below, then let it drain completely. Resume checking by moisture rather than jumping to a rigid calendar.
Wilting should not be the only cue. A waterlogged plant can wilt because damaged roots cannot supply the leaves, which is why the moisture check comes first.
Evaluate light and recent changes
Pothos tolerates lower light but performs best in bright, filtered or indirect light. Wisconsin Extension warns that it does not tolerate much direct sun and should be kept out of drafts; North Carolina Extension notes that low light can reduce variegation.
Ask what changed during the two or three weeks before symptoms appeared:
- Was the plant moved to a brighter window without acclimation?
- Did a seasonal sun angle begin reaching the leaves directly?
- Was it moved farther from a window, behind a curtain, or beneath an overhang?
- Is it next to a heating vent, air conditioner, exterior door, or cold glass?
Move a light-starved plant toward brighter filtered light in stages. Move a scorched plant out of direct afternoon sun but do not put it in a dark corner. Existing bleached or necrotic tissue will not repair; success is measured by stable, normally colored new leaves.
Inspect for pests with magnification
Wisconsin Extension lists mealybugs and scale as the most common pothos pests and spider mites as an occasional problem. The University of Minnesota indoor-pest guide recommends examining upper and lower leaf surfaces, nodes, pot rims, and crevices, using a 10-power hand lens when possible.
Look for evidence rather than spraying preventively:
- white cottony masses in leaf axils or on roots suggest mealybugs;
- tan or bark-colored attached bumps may be scale;
- fine webbing and stippled foliage support spider-mite activity;
- sticky honeydew on leaves or the shelf often accompanies aphids, mealybugs, or some scales.
Isolate a suspect plant from the rest of the collection. For a minor infestation, physical removal, a thorough rinse, or a houseplant-labeled insecticidal soap may be appropriate. Follow the product label and test a small area first. Do not combine pesticides, oils, soaps, alcohol, and household cleaners in an improvised mixture; leaf injury can look like the original problem. If a low-value plant has a heavy infestation, discarding it can be safer for the collection than repeated treatment.
Consider fertilizer only after water, roots, light, and pests
Yellowing is often described online as a specific nutrient deficiency based on vein color. That shortcut is unreliable without the plant’s fertilizer, water, pH, root, and growth history. Damaged roots can produce nutrient-like symptoms even when nutrients are present.
Wisconsin Extension recommends modest feeding during active growth and no fertilizer during the winter rest period; it also notes that excess fertilizer salts can blacken leaf margins or tips and accompany yellowing. If the plant has been fertilized heavily, has crust on the media or pot, and has healthy roots and free drainage, flush the mix thoroughly with water and pause feeding. If it has been in exhausted mix for a long time, is actively growing, and every other condition checks out, use a complete houseplant fertilizer at its labeled rate. More is not faster.
Decide whether to prune, propagate, or seek a diagnosis
Remove a fully yellow leaf with clean scissors if it no longer contributes to the plant. Do not strip every imperfect leaf during recovery; green tissue still supports growth.
If root or stem rot has advanced but some vines remain firm, take cuttings from symptom-free tissue above the damage as a backup. Pothos cuttings root readily, but sanitize the tool between diseased and healthy sections. Discard cuttings with soft nodes or spreading lesions.
Seek help from a local Extension office or plant diagnostic clinic when yellowing continues despite corrected care, when spots spread in a consistent pattern, or when a valuable plant has progressive stem or root damage. Photos of the whole plant, both leaf surfaces, roots, container, and growing location are more diagnostic than a close-up of one yellow leaf.
Safety boundary for people and pets
Pothos contains insoluble calcium oxalates. The ASPCA Animal Poison Control Center classifies golden pothos as toxic to cats and dogs and lists oral irritation, drooling, vomiting, and difficulty swallowing among possible signs. Keep the plant and discarded cuttings away from pets and young children, and wash hands after handling sap. If a pet chews the plant or develops symptoms, contact a veterinarian or animal poison-control service promptly; do not use a gardening article as treatment guidance.
The central rule is simple: diagnose conditions, not colors. A measured root-zone check and a close pest inspection usually tell you more than the yellow leaf itself.
